Overview

In Europe, the emerging discipline of geodesign was earmarked by the first Geodesign Summit held in 2013 at the GeoFort, the Netherlands. Here researchers and practitionersnbsp;from 28 different countries gathered to exchange ideas on how to merge the spatial sciences and design worlds.nbsp;This book brings together experiences from this international group of spatial planners, architects, landscape designers, archaeologists, and geospatial scientists to explorenbsp;the notion ofnbsp;'Geodesign thinking', wherebynbsp;spatial technologies (such as integrated 3D modelling, network analysis, visualization tools, and information dashboards) are used to answer 'what if' questions to design alternatives on aspects like urban visibility, flood risks, sustainability, economic development, heritagenbsp;appreciation and public engagement.nbsp;The book offers a single source of geodesign theory from a European perspective by first introducing the geodesign framework, thennbsp;exploring various case studies on solving complex, dynamic, and multi-stakeholder design challenges.nbsp;This book will appeal to practitioners and researchers alike who are eagernbsp;to bring design analysis, intelligent planning, and consensus building to a whole new level.nbsp;
